Vivian Lau serves as the Head of Research at Clay, where she leverages her extensive 15 years of experience in insights and user research to drive innovation and product development within the collaborative design platform. Under her leadership, Clay is transforming the way creative teams deliver 3D assets, making the process faster and more efficient. Vivian's expertise lies in building and scaling impactful research teams, particularly in early-stage startups and new verticals at high-growth tech companies. She is adept at employing a diverse range of research methodologies, including marketing research, quantitative and qualitative analysis, and usability testing, to inform product strategy and enhance user experience.
